Several reasons for not loving Google Chrome and Opera.
Too often, Chrome and Opera have a hard time to find a (new, uncached) site when you ask those browsers to go there. The connection is either slow or won't succeed. Trying a second time often resolves the problem, but why would we need two efforts?
There's often heavy flicker on page transition with Chrome.
Simply pressing F5 won't always clear the cache with Chrome.
Opera has a tendency to produce flicker with Flash.
Parent.scrollTop from within an iframe makes Chrome feel uneasy. The parent window moves to a negative top position.
I created workarounds to resolve these issues, but that doesn't provide an excuse for bad behavior on the part of Chrome and Opera.
Many ugly things have been said about IE, and rightly so, but it seems that IE9 must be preferred now to Chrome and Opera (if we ignore IE safety vulnerabilities).
And FF is by far the best. It may sometimes load pages slowly, but it DOES load them, always!
